The National Institute of Communicable Diseases (NICD) says all children must be immunised against measles.

There has been an outbreak of the virus over the past few weeks with the majority of cases occurring in Pretoria.

However, the virus has now spread to other areas in the province.

The health department has launched a massive immunisation campaign aimed at toddlers and school children.

"I think it is critical that parents allow their children to be part of this vaccination campaign. Measles is a serious illness that can result in pneumonias and even death," said the institute's Lucille Bloomberg
